Database Architect – DBARC0319007

Date Posted: 03-01-2019, Job Code: DBARC0319007, Job Location: Parlin, NJ Job Timing: Full – time

Job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Work in in Agile/ SCRUM based project structure & environment and collaborate with system architects, design & business analysts, software engineers and stakeholders to understand business/ project requirements.
  • Follow Agile Scrum process and participate in sprint meetings, daily and weekly demo and review meetings
  • Gather software project requirements, data and business requirements from customers, project stakeholders and engineers.
  • Analyze user requirements and functional specifications and convert them into formal Functional specification and Interfacing with client.
  • Work with the project team for designing databases to support business applications, ensuring system scalability, security, performance and reliability.
  • Develop the architecture of the application database & strategies at modeling, design and implementation stages to meed business requirements.
  • Design & Produce ER diagrams, Dataflow, function Hierarchy; generate DDL statements to create database entities like tables, views, sequences, functions, synonyms, indexes, triggers, packages and stored procedures.
  • Implement database servers, connections & interfaces between applications and develop load-balancing processes.
  • Create and setup database clusters, backup & recovery processes.
  • Develop Database Triggers and enforce security; create and modify SQL*Loader scripts for migrating flat file data. Develop using advanced SQL features like Inline views, advanced Joins, Decodes, Indexing, Bulk Inserts, Bulk collects and other analytical functions.
  • Develop SQL program to generate the XML files using PL/SQL and automate the process using Unix shell scripts and develop SQL Queries to fetch complex data.
  • Involve in the testing of the database schema against business requirements and raise change requests to the project team.
  • Analyze, debug, troubleshoot and resolve time-critical application issues. Plan and update database software through patches as required.
  • Analyze and update code for optimization and performance fine tuning of the application using Explain Plan, Hints, Indexing and Partitioning of tables.
  • Monitor database performance and provide technical support for critical issues.
  • Prepare comprehensive documentation for database architecture, database design, database schemas, data flow & models.
  • Demonstrate database and application technical functionality, operation procedures, performance, security and reliability to the project stakeholders and clients.
